
Millia -The ending- is a visual novel made by Millia Soft using Ren'py. The game was successfully funded on kickstarter.com in early 2015.

Millia -The Ending- is a rather short visual novel made by Millia Soft, with a few choices to make, of which those choices will lead to 3 different endings. Even though there are quite a number of translation errors throughout the game, the story is well written and very engaging. The art is beautiful and the song 'Akogare no hana' fits the story really well. As stated above, Millia -The Ending- is the made by Millia Soft which is an indie VN studio and it is a cut above most of the other indie visual novels that are on Steam right now. Do consider reading Millia -The Ending- as it is worth your time and the game isn't too expensive. I am definitely looking forward to other works produced by MIllia Soft!
I don't know how this got in my steam library, but since it's here, I have to review it. And unfortunately, I can't recommend this game. The writing needs serious revision, the plot is boring, the music is repetitive, and, of course, the sister isn't blood-related. Feels more like a kinetic novel than a visual novel; I clicked as fast as I could for ten minutes and didn't come to a single choice. Other reviews indicate there are only three choices to make in the whole game?
